Understanding the Stoma Bag: 

Living with a stoma bag indeed marks a profound shift in one’s life. A stoma bag is required when a person's body can't eliminate waste in the usual manner. This could be due to several medical conditions, including colorectal cancer, inflammatory bowel disease (like Crohn's disease or ulcerative colitis), diverticulitis, or as a result of surgical intervention, such as a colectomy.

What Exactly is a Stoma Bag?

A stoma bag is attached to an opening (stoma) on the abdomen. This opening is created surgically to divert waste (urine or feces) out of the body. The bag collects this waste, and the wearer can then dispose of it. It’s a critical device that allows individuals to continue their lives despite serious health issues.

Reasons for Wearing a Stoma Bag

Stoma bags are most commonly needed following surgeries related to the gastrointestinal or urinary systems. These surgeries may be necessitated by cancer, blockages, or diseases that damage the digestive or urinary organs. In some cases, the stoma is temporary and allows the body to heal. In other instances, it is a permanent solution.

Daily Life with a Stoma Bag

Living with a stoma bag requires significant adjustment. Initially, there is a learning curve in managing the bag – like knowing how to empty and change it, recognising signs of potential complications, and understanding how to care for the skin around the stoma.

Daily activities such as bathing, dressing, and even sleeping may need to be adapted to accommodate the stoma bag. Clothing choices might change to ensure comfort and discretion. Additionally, those with a stoma bag might need to modify their diet to prevent blockages and reduce gas or odors.

There is also a psychological aspect to consider. Adjusting to the physical presence of the bag and dealing with potential body image issues can be challenging. It’s common for individuals to experience a range of emotions, from relief at the resolution of painful symptoms to anxiety about social reactions and the stoma’s appearance.

Social interactions can be impacted as well. Explaining the condition to others, handling any questions or misconceptions, and managing any potential noise or odor from the bag are aspects that individuals need to navigate. Despite increasing awareness, there’s still a stigma attached to wearing a stoma bag, making public outings and social engagements a potential source of stress.

Traveling also requires planning. Carrying additional supplies, managing airport security, and dealing with restroom accessibility are just a few of the considerations. However, with proper preparation, individuals with a stoma bag can travel comfortably and confidently.
